Course Content

• Agricultural Production Cost Accounting Principles
• Crop Modeling and Simulation Techniques
• Livestock Production Cost Analysis and Budgeting
• Data Analysis for Agricultural Cost Modeling (using statistical software like R or SAS)
• Economic Principles and Farm Management Decision Making
• Agricultural Production Cost Modeling: Software Applications
• Risk Management and Sensitivity Analysis in Agricultural Modeling
• Precision Agriculture and Cost Optimization
• Case Studies in Agricultural Production Cost Modeling

Career path

Career Role (Agricultural Production Cost Modeling) Description
Agricultural Economist Analyze production costs, market trends, and farm profitability; develop cost-effective strategies. High industry relevance.
Farm Management Consultant Advise farmers on optimizing production costs using modeling techniques; improve efficiency and profitability. Strong demand.
Data Analyst (Agriculture) Analyze large datasets to identify cost-saving opportunities and trends within agricultural production. Growing job market.
Precision Agriculture Specialist Utilize cost modeling to optimize resource allocation in precision farming; improve yields while reducing expenses. High skill demand.
Agricultural Business Manager Manage all aspects of agricultural businesses, including cost control and budget management. Excellent career prospects.
